Commerce Street/South 11th Street is a light rail station on Tacoma Link in Tacoma, Washington, United States. The station officially opened for service on September 15, 2011 as an infill station, and is located one block south of the Commerce Street transit mall, served by Sound Transit Express, Pierce Transit and Intercity Transit buses. It was proposed by the City of Tacoma in 2010 and approved by the Sound Transit Board in September 2010. The station was officially named "Commerce Street" by a Sound Transit Board motion passed on July 28, 2011.
